“Wuxiang” originates from Buddhist philosophy, as stated in the Diamond Sutra: “All forms are delusion. If one sees that all forms are non-forms, they will see the Tathagata.” This means that only by not clinging to specific images can one see the true essence.
Therefore, the most prominent feature of jade Buddha statues without facial features is the absence of depiction of the five senses, leaving a blank space. The creative concept behind them is that “Buddha has no fixed appearance, but takes all sentient beings as his appearance”, suggesting that the image of Buddha should be “seen” through the inner perception of the viewer
